During the 2020-2021 academic year, Bowling Green State University - Main Campus handed out 60 bachelor's degrees in liberal arts. This is a decrease of 17% over the previous year when 72 degrees were handed out.

BGSU Liberal Arts Bachelor’s Program

Of the 60 students who graduated with a Bachelor’s in liberal studies from BGSU in 2021, 43% were men and 57% were women.

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 68% of 2021 graduates were in this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Bowling Green State University - Main Campus with a bachelor's in liberal studies.

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 9
Hispanic or Latino 6
White 41
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 4
